Demand Spikes for Firewall Management Applications


Data security is top of mind of most IT administrators in a never-ending battle against cybercriminals. A report released earlier this year, “Unsecured Economies: Protecting Vital Information” by Purdue University’s Center for Education and Research in Information Assurance and Security and sponsored by McAfee (News - Alert), revealed that cybercrime may have cost businesses on average $4.6 million from data and intellectual property exposure in 2008.

 
IT administrators are not surprisingly in an ongoing hunt for the best solutions to prevent unauthorized data access. And to illustrate, Secure Passage reportedly announced that in one month hundreds of organizations have downloaded Secure Passage’s Firewall Auditor. This is a free application enabling firewall administrators to quickly and easily audit firewall configurations to ensure that they are enforcing security and compliance regulations.
 
Of the hundreds of organizations that have downloaded the application, more than 175 are now actively using it to conduct Payment Card Industry Data Security Standard audits. This early and significant adoption rate also demonstrates an elevated demand for Secure Passage’s FireMon-based technologies that it says improves firewall management capabilities.

Once the application has been activated, users can quickly and easily audit their firewalls for adherence to the PCI (News - Alert) DSS. They can then generate comprehensive and accurate reports that can be used to prove to auditors that firewalls are in compliance and to identify non-compliant configurations that should be changed. Reportedly the first solution of its kind available to the IT security market, Firewall Auditor is based on FireMon, but does not require FireMon to be installed or to operate.
 
With Secure Passage Firewall Auditor, firewall administrators can and are quickly and easily:
 
* Retrieving and importing firewall configurations from Check Point, Cisco (News - Alert) and Juniper firewalls
 
* Inspecting configurations for non-compliance with major industry and government regulations
 
* Producing accurate reports that display where and why rules and policies are non-compliant
 
* Taking steps to remediate non-compliant configurations
   
With Secure Passage Firewall Auditor’s PCI DSS report template, IT administrators can quickly and easily evaluate 15 PCI DSS requirements from sections one, two and six. They can also specify key input criteria to customize the audit to their organization's unique environment.
